    Red face how do i centre pages for different resolutions

    i have made my site, but iv realised on different screen resolutions it looks different, different sizes, which i know is obvious, but other sites seem to have the page in the centre no matter the screen resolution, can anyone help me? iv clicked page properties and centre page, but it doesnt seem to work

    Default Re: how do i centre pages for different resolutions

    Hi cannock

    Are your page widths set to '800 in page properties and ticked center in browser and then republished? '800 width would be the key, if your pages are made larger than that, you will see the need for sideways scrolling for those viewing in lower resolution and the page won't be centered.

    Default Re: how do i centre pages for different resolutions

    scubadiver:

    Go to an empty part of a page ( not on a text portion ) and right click. This should bring up page properties click on page properties and set both resolution and centering. Do this on all pages ( I like 800X600 because it eliminates side scroll ). If you have problems setting to 800 you may need to change placement of graphics or templet borders.
